Grave Markers Ashland Ohio

Grave markers (or occasionally referred to as markers) are smaller in size and also can be put over one or numerous tombs. They are one item (instead of an upright headstone, which may include a stone and base) and most frequently seen in a single or companion size. There are different types of grave markers, consisting of lawn markers, bevel markers, and also slants.

Lawn markers are commonly flush with the ground and 4 inches thick. These types of grave markers are typically used for a one-person headstone.

Bevel markers are headstones for sale that are very comparable in size to lawn markers. However, the notable distinction with this sort of marker is that they are not flat with the ground, but rather stand approximately 6 inches off the ground with a face that is slanted a little downward.

Slants are the largest sort of marker, as they generally stand 16 inches off the ground and the face of the monolith is heavily inclined downward. You have the ability to install a slant straight onto the ground, or position it on a base to give it an added height.

Headstone vs. Grave Marker Ashland Ohio

Headstone vs. Grave Marker

Words “headstone” and “grave marker” are sometimes utilized mutually by households that are seeking to recognize the life of their loved one after a fatality in the family has occurred. Typically, the term “headstone” refers to any type of memorial that is put front of the cemetery plot in order to recognize the memory of the deceased. “Grave marker”, on the other hand, is commonly a smaller sized, one-piece marker that is placed in graveyard. Despite which term you make use of, there is no right or incorrect answer when describing these two types of tombstones, as they both get used interchangeably.

Memorial Headstone Types

There are a variety of various kinds of memorials. Having referenced markers above, the various other kinds of headstone memorials are upright headstones, which can be found in single and companion sizes. A single upright headstone is utilized to honor simply someone who has passed away, whereas a companion upright is utilized to recognize 2 or more memories. Upright headstones can be available in a range of shapes and also granite colors, so be sure to consult with your household to see if there are any kind of specific preferences that may need to be attended to when making your loved one’s memorial.

Memorial Benches & Bench Headstones In Ashland OH

Memorial benches are distinct headstones, as they take the form of a bench as opposed to the standard upright stone on a base. If you have done any looking for headstones for sale online, after that you most definitely have actually seen different types of memorial benches.

There are 2 popular kinds of memorial benches that are made use of instead of standard tombstones. The flat bench seat memorial is one that is straightforward yet stylish in nature. It includes a flat seat with 2 different legs affixed for security. The various other type of memorial bench is the park bench. This is a bench that has a backrest, where all of the inscription will be engraved.

Searching online for “headstones near me” might populate a wide range of outcomes, including monument businesses, graveyards, and funeral homes in Ashland, OH. While markers and also headstones can be supplied by any one of these kinds of organizations, it is necessary to do your own investigation when purchasing a tombstone. Nevertheless, this memorial will be a homage to the deceased forever, so it is important that it gets finished correctly and efficiently the very first time.

As an example, you will certainly want to see to it that the company you are collaborating with has an installation procedure in place. Believe it or not, there are companies that will offer a headstone to families and afterwards ask, “Where do you want it to be delivered?”. The majority of graveyards will not accept delivered gravestones for responsibility purposes, and also they will not install them at the grave for the exact same reason. Always make certain that the business you are purchasing from will certainly be placing your headstone and that the installation is included in your purchase cost.

Granite Colors For Headstones Ashland OH

There are many different granite colors that are quarried around the world. Many granites are imported into the United States. However, there are some quarries in the United States, including in Barre, Vermont and also Elberton, Georgia. These two are the most popular quarries for gray granite in the United States.

Nonetheless, if you are looking for a special granite color that varies from the traditional gray color, you may look at rose, black, or blue, as these granites are also preferred as well as give a various appearance than the typical gray.

No matter the granite you pick for your loved one’s headstone, granite is the material you will certainly want to utilize in order to make sure that your headstone stands the test of time as well as can stand up to outside weather once it is set at the graveyard in Ashland.

Black Granite Headstones In Ashland

Over recent years, family members have actually been inquiring about black granite gravestones more often. The popular black granite that is made use of for headstones is quarried in India and after that imported into the nation. At our company, this is one of the most asked for color when a family contacts us. Black granite has come to be increasingly in demand because of its clean look as well as its special character that enables a image to be laser etched directly into the granite.

Engraving Your Headstone

When designing your headstone, there are a number of various directions that can be taken. The most common is typical sandblasting. This is where the layout is carved using a sandblaster. The majority of headstones in cemeteries are engraved using this standard method, which has actually been used for a long period of time. Any kind of granite type can be sandblasted to give it the preferred layout.

Much more lately, relatives have actually elected to have their style laser etched right into the grave stone via a process called laser etching. This procedure can just be performed on black granite because of its unique property. Laser etching is performed on a laser machine and is a a lot more shallow kind of inscription than traditional sandblasting. Due to this, it does often tend to fade with time. Nonetheless, laser etching on black granite is still exceptionally prominent in today’s age, as you can get very detailed with the style and even etch specific scenes and {photos||photo portraits}, straight into the black granite headstone.

Photo Portraits On Headstones For Graves

You will find 2 manners in which you can add a picture of the deceased to their headstone. One option is by laser etching. This type of photo can only be carried out when engraving black granite.

The other sort of picture that you can incorporate is a porcelain picture. A porcelain photo can be created in color or black and white, and can be done on any kind of granite headstone, eve black granite! Through a one-of-a-kind process, a photo of your loved one can be recessed straight into the memorial to make sure that the surface of the imageis flat with the memorial. The picture has a clear porcelain covering that protects it from climate as well as all-natural damage.

The typical cost of a conventional flat headstone is roughly $1,000, although it can range from $1,000 to $3,000 depending on size, granite color, and engraving styles. Depending on the shape, size, granite color, and carved pattern, more ornate upright headstones can cost anywhere from $2,500 to $10,000.
The term “gravestone” dates from the late 1300s, while “tombstone” dates from the mid-1500s. A headstone was a grave monument put at the head of a grave, as the name suggests. According to the Oxford English Dictionary, it is the newest of the three words, appearing in 1676.
Your cemetery will have their own separate fee, which will cover the cemetery pouring the concrete foundation that your headstone will sit on once installed.
At a glance, comparing price only may in fact seem like it is cheaper to buy a headstone online. However, there is usually a reason. Oftentimes, when you buy a headstone online, there is not an installation process in place, so it is up to you to find an installer and coordinate the installation with the cemetery yourself. If your cemetery does not accept shipped headstones for liability purposes, then you will need to make additional arrangements when it comes to finding a destination for your headstone once it is completed with the online company.
Flat burial markers are the least expensive of all the headstone options. Flat grave markers made of granite typically cost between $1,000 and $3,000 on average, depending on a few factors.
